多注册中心
同服务多注册中心注册:同时将服务注册到多个注册中心
<?xml version="1.0" encoding="UTF-8"?>
<beans xmlns="http://www.springframework.org/schema/beans"
xmlns:xsi="http://www.w3.org/2001/XMLSchema-instance"
xmlns:dubbo="http://dubbo.apache.org/schema/dubbo"
xsi:schemaLocation="http://www.springframework.org/schema/beans http://www.springframework.org/schema/beans/spring-beans-4.3.xsd http://dubbo.apache.org/schema/dubbo http://dubbo.apache.org/schema/dubbo/dubbo.xsd">
<dubbo:application name="world" />
<!-- 多注册中心配置 -->
<dubbo:registry id="hangzhouRegistry" address="10.20.141.150:9090" />
<dubbo:registry id="qingdaoRegistry" address="10.20.141.151:9010" default="false" />
<!-- 向多个注册中心注册 -->
<dubbo:service interface="com.alibaba.hello.api.HelloService" version="1.0.0" ref="helloService" registry="hangzhouRegistry,qingdaoRegistry" />
</beans>
不同服务向不同注册中心注册
<?xml version="1.0" encoding="UTF-8"?>
<beans xmlns="http://www.springframework.org/schema/beans"
xmlns:xsi="http://www.w3.org/2001/XMLSchema-instance"
xmlns:dubbo="http://dubbo.apache.org/schema/dubbo"
xsi:schemaLocation="http://www.springframework.org/schema/beans http://www.springframework.org/schema/beans/spring-beans-4.3.xsd http://dubbo.apache.org/schema/dubbo http://dubbo.apache.org/schema/dubbo/dubbo.xsd">
<dubbo:application name="world" />
<!-- 多注册中心配置 -->
<dubbo:registry id="chinaRegistry" address="10.20.141.150:9090" />
<dubbo:registry id="intlRegistry" address="10.20.154.177:9010" default="false" />
<!-- 向中文站注册中心注册 -->
<dubbo:service interface="com.alibaba.hello.api.HelloService" version="1.0.0" ref="helloService" registry="chinaRegistry" />
<!-- 向国际站注册中心注册 -->
<dubbo:service interface="com.alibaba.hello.api.DemoService" version="1.0.0" ref="demoService" registry="intlRegistry" />
</beans>
多注册中心引用:客户端调用不同注册中心的同一接口
<?xml version="1.0" encoding="UTF-8"?>
<beans xmlns="http://www.springframework.org/schema/beans"
xmlns:xsi="http://www.w3.org/2001/XMLSchema-instance"
xmlns:dubbo="http://dubbo.apache.org/schema/dubbo"
xsi:schemaLocation="http://www.springframework.org/schema/beans http://www.springframework.org/schema/beans/spring-beans-4.3.xsd http://dubbo.apache.org/schema/dubbo http://dubbo.apache.org/schema/dubbo/dubbo.xsd">
<dubbo:application name="world" />
<!-- 多注册中心配置 -->
<dubbo:registry id="chinaRegistry" address="10.20.141.150:9090" />
<dubbo:registry id="intlRegistry" address="10.20.154.177:9010" default="false" />
<!-- 引用中文站服务 -->
<dubbo:reference id="chinaHelloService" interface="com.alibaba.hello.api.HelloService" version="1.0.0" registry="chinaRegistry" />
<!-- 引用国际站站服务 -->
<dubbo:reference id="intlHelloService" interface="com.alibaba.hello.api.HelloService" version="1.0.0" registry="intlRegistry" />
</beans>
注册中心配置多个地址
<?xml version="1.0" encoding="UTF-8"?>
<beans xmlns="http://www.springframework.org/schema/beans"
xmlns:xsi="http://www.w3.org/2001/XMLSchema-instance"
xmlns:dubbo="http://dubbo.apache.org/schema/dubbo"
xsi:schemaLocation="http://www.springframework.org/schema/beans http://www.springframework.org/schema/beans/spring-beans-4.3.xsd http://dubbo.apache.org/schema/dubbo http://dubbo.apache.org/schema/dubbo/dubbo.xsd">
<dubbo:application name="world" />
<!-- 多注册中心配置,竖号分隔表示同时连接多个不同注册中心,同一注册中心的多个集群地址用逗号分隔 -->
<dubbo:registry address="10.20.141.150:9090|10.20.154.177:9010" />
<!-- 引用服务 -->
<dubbo:reference id="helloService" interface="com.alibaba.hello.api.HelloService" version="1.0.0" />
</beans>

UrlUtils
public class UrlUtils {
public static List<URL> parseURLs(String address, Map<String, String> defaults) {
if (StringUtils.isEmpty(address)) {
throw new IllegalArgumentException("Address is not allowed to be empty, please re-enter.");
}
String[] addresses = REGISTRY_SPLIT_PATTERN.split(address);
//CommonConstants.REGISTRY_SPLIT_PATTERN = Pattern.compile("\s*[|;]+\s*");
//使用|、;,分割字符串adress,转换为数组存储
if (addresses == null || addresses.length == 0) {
throw new IllegalArgumentException("Addresses is not allowed to be empty, please re-enter."); //here won't be empty
}
List<URL> registries = new ArrayList<URL>();
for (String addr : addresses) {
registries.add(parseURL(addr, defaults));
}
return registries;
}

ReferenceConfig
public class ReferenceConfig<T> extends ReferenceConfigBase<T> {
private T createProxy(Map<String, String> referenceParameters) {
if (shouldJvmRefer(referenceParameters)) {
createInvokerForLocal(referenceParameters);
} else {
urls.clear();
if (url != null && url.length() > 0) {
// user specified URL, could be peer-to-peer address, or register center's address.
parseUrl(referenceParameters);
} else {
// if protocols not in jvm checkRegistry
if (!LOCAL_PROTOCOL.equalsIgnoreCase(getProtocol())) {
aggregateUrlFromRegistry(referenceParameters);
}
}
createInvokerForRemote(); //创建远程服务invoker
}
if (logger.isInfoEnabled()) {
logger.info("Referred dubbo service " + interfaceClass.getName());
}
URL consumerUrl = new ServiceConfigURL(CONSUMER_PROTOCOL, referenceParameters.get(REGISTER_IP_KEY), 0,
referenceParameters.get(INTERFACE_KEY), referenceParameters);
consumerUrl = consumerUrl.setScopeModel(getScopeModel());
consumerUrl = consumerUrl.setServiceModel(consumerModel);
MetadataUtils.publishServiceDefinition(consumerUrl);
// create service proxy
return (T) proxyFactory.getProxy(invoker, ProtocolUtils.isGeneric(generic));
}
private void createInvokerForRemote() {
if (urls.size() == 1) { //单注册中心
URL curUrl = urls.get(0);
invoker = protocolSPI.refer(interfaceClass,curUrl);
if (!UrlUtils.isRegistry(curUrl)){
List<Invoker<?>> invokers = new ArrayList<>();
invokers.add(invoker);
invoker = Cluster.getCluster(scopeModel, Cluster.DEFAULT).join(new StaticDirectory(curUrl, invokers), true);
}
} else { //多注册中心
List<Invoker<?>> invokers = new ArrayList<>();
URL registryUrl = null;
for (URL url : urls) { //遍历注册中心,创建invoker
// For multi-registry scenarios, it is not checked whether each referInvoker is available.
// Because this invoker may become available later.
invokers.add(protocolSPI.refer(interfaceClass, url));
if (UrlUtils.isRegistry(url)) {
// use last registry url
registryUrl = url; //使用最后一个注册中心地址
}
}
if (registryUrl != null) {
// registry url is available
// for multi-subscription scenario, use 'zone-aware' policy by default
String cluster = registryUrl.getParameter(CLUSTER_KEY, ZoneAwareCluster.NAME);
// The invoker wrap sequence would be: ZoneAwareClusterInvoker(StaticDirectory) -> FailoverClusterInvoker
// (RegistryDirectory, routing happens here) -> Invoker
invoker = Cluster.getCluster(registryUrl.getScopeModel(), cluster, false).join(new StaticDirectory(registryUrl, invokers), false);
//先用staticDirectory构建ZoneAwareClusterInvoker,
//ZoneAwareClusterInvoker先执行,
//再执行failoverClusterInvoker(默认为该incoker,也可为其他invoker,由容错策略cluster设置)
} else {
// not a registry url, must be direct invoke.
if (CollectionUtils.isEmpty(invokers)) {
throw new IllegalArgumentException("invokers == null");
}
URL curUrl = invokers.get(0).getUrl();
String cluster = curUrl.getParameter(CLUSTER_KEY, Cluster.DEFAULT);
invoker = Cluster.getCluster(scopeModel, cluster).join(new StaticDirectory(curUrl, invokers), true);
}
}
}
配置示例
,间隔 ==> 表示同一集群
# 服务提供端(dubbo-provider)
dubbo:
application:
name: dubbo-provider
#register-mode: instance
registry:
group: dubbo
protocol: zookeeper
address: localhost:2181,localhost:2182 #localhost:2181、localhost:2182为同一集群
# 服务消费端(dubbo-consumer)
dubbo:
application:
name: dubbo-consumer
registry:
group: dubbo
protocol: zookeeper
address: localhost:2181,localhost:2182 #localhost:2181、localhost:2182为同一集群
| 或者 ;间隔 ==> 表示不在同一集群内
# 服务提供端(dubbo-provider)
dubbo:
application:
name: dubbo-provider
#register-mode: instance
registry:
group: dubbo
protocol: zookeeper #使用zookeeper
address: localhost:2181|localhost:2182 #localhost:2181、localhost:2182为不同集群
# 服务消费端(dubbo-onsumer)
dubbo:
application:
name: dubbo-provider
#register-mode: instance
registry:
group: dubbo
protocol: zookeeper
address: localhost:2181|localhost:2182 #localhost:2181、localhost:2182为不同集群
注册中心分别配置
# 服务提供端(dubbo-provider)
dubbo:
application:
name: dubbo-provider
registries:
2181: //注册中心的key
group: dubbo4
protocol: zookeeper
address: localhost:2181
2182: //注册中心的key
group: dubbo3
protocol: zookeeper
address: localhost:2182
default: true //如果不指定,默认使用该注册中心
protocol:
name: dubbo
port: 20880
服务暴露
@DubboService(registry = {"2182"})
//@DubboService(registry = {"2181","2182"})
public class HelloServiceImpl implements HelloService {
@Override
public List<String> hello() {
System.out.println("hello provider");
return Collections.singletonList("hello provider");
}
}
服务调用
@RestController
public class HelloController {
@DubboReference(registry = {"2181"})
private HelloService helloService;
@RequestMapping("/hello")
public String hello(){
helloService.hello().forEach(System.out::print);
return "hello consumer 2";
}
}
